January 09, 2022
Exelixis Announces Preliminary Fourth Quarter and Full Year 2021 Financial Results, Provides 2022 Financial Guidance, and Outlines Key Priorities and Milestones for 2022
(Businesswire)
- "Potential new development candidates:...With respect to biotherapeutics, these include XB010, the first custom ADC generated through the company’s collaboration network, which was designated a development candidate in late 2021 and will enter preclinical development shortly....Additional ADCs advancing through discovery target a range of tumor antigens including AMHR2, ROR1/2, TF and DLL3 and utilize a variety of conjugation technologies and payloads. In addition, Exelixis is advancing two bispecific programs through its Invenra collaboration that combine a PD-L1 targeting arm with either a CD47 targeting arm to block a macrophage checkpoint, or an NKG2A targeting arm to promote NK cell activation in the tumor microenvironment."
